Features

  • Gain-of-1 bandwidth = 1.4GHz/gain-of-2 bandwidth = 800MHz.
  • 6000V/µs slew rate.
  • Single and dual supply operation from 5V to 12V.
  • Low noise = 1.7nV/√Hz.
  • 8.5mA supply current.
  • Fast enable/disable (EL5166 only).
  • 600MHz family - (EL5164 and EL5165).
  • 400MHz family - (EL5162 and EL5163).
  • 200MHz family - (EL5160 and EL5161).
  • Pb-free available (RoHS compliant).

EL5166, EL5167 1.4GHz Current Feedback Amplifiers with Enable The EL5166 and EL5167 amplifiers are of the current feedback variety and exhibit a very high bandwidth of 1.4GHz at AV = +1 and 800MHz at AV = +2. This makes these amplifiers ideal for today's high speed video and monitor applications, as well as a number of RF and IF frequency designs. With a supply current of just 8.5mA and the ability to run from a single supply voltage from 5V to 12V, these amplifiers offer very high performance for little power consumption. The EL5166 also incorporates an enable and disable function to reduce the supply current to 13µA typical per amplifier. Allowing the CE pin to float or applying a low logic level will enable the amplifier.
